Audi A8 2010

Model A8 made in 2010 by Audi got 1 consumer complain as well as 41 service bulletins. Consumer complaints with reference to visibility. . Technical service bulletines regarding digital instrument panel and electrical system. The car has one 4.2 engine.

Consumer Complaints


Fail datemilesoccurencesPurchase date
VISIBILITY
04/12/20101
 Information redacted pursuant to the freedom of information act (foia), 5 u.s.c. 552(b)(6) my complaint covers all radar based blind spot monitoring devices. the following scenario has personally occurred to me twice within the last month. i was one in a line of vehicles driving on a clear highway when an audi with blind spot monitoring entered the highway directly in front of the line of vehicles. because of the low power of its blind spot monitoring system's radar coupled with the effects of the inverse square law of physics, the radar detector equipped driver closest to the audi thought they were being monitored by instant on police radar and jammed on their brakes, causing panic stopping by all of the vehicles behind them. myself and several other vehicles were required to use the road's shoulder to avoid being rear-ended. i feel fairly confident that within the us there have been accidents caused by these devices, yet the accident will never be attributed to the device because the driver with the blind spot monitoring device will be oblivious to the chaos they caused behind them, and they'll ignorantly continue driving. these devices should immediately be disabled, and anyone that thinks these are a good idea should be reminded that they should turn their head and look over their shoulder before merging onto a highway, or changing lanes. let's promote smarter, more aware drivers, and not smarter cars.
